Examples of the "Nigerian scam" that flood my email box everyday.

Monday, February 16, 2004

This gentleman is offering me a healthy 5% on a property deal worth $230M.

Now that's easy money!

All I have to do is act as property agent for him and his money which is, of course, in escrow.

All he needs from me are a few details, so that he can discuss the "modalities".

Don't think so chummy.

Dear sir,
ASSISTANCE REQUIRED FOR ACQUISITION OF ESTATE
I write to inform you of my desire to acquire estates or landed properties in
your country on behalf of the Director of Contracts and Finance Allocation of
the Federal Ministry of Works and Housing in Nigeria.
Considering his very strategic and influential position, he would want the
transaction to be strictly confidential as possible. He further wants his
identity to remain undisclosed at least for now, until the completion of the
transaction. Hence our desire to have an overseas agent. I have therefore been
directed to inquire if you would agree to act as our overseas agent in order to
actualize this transaction.
The deal, in brief, is that the funds with which we intend to carry out our
proposed investments in your country is presently in an Escrow account in a
Finance Trust & Security House in Europe. We need your assistance to transfer
the funds to your country in a convenient bank account that will be provided by
you before we can put the funds into use in your country. For this, you shall be
considered to have executed a contract for the Federal Ministry of Works and
Housing in Nigeria for which payment should be effected to you by the Ministry.
The contract sum of which shall run into US$230 Million, of which your share
shall be 5% if you agree to be our overseas agent.
As soon as payment is effected, and the amount mentioned above is successfully
transferred into your account, we intend to use our own share in acquiring some
estates abroad. You shall also serve as our agent.
In the light of this, I would like you to forward to me the following
information:
1. Your company name and address
2. Your personal fax number
3. Your personal telephone number for easy communication.
You are requested to communicate your acceptance of this proposal through my
above stated email address and my confidential fax number +234 1 759-3335, after
which we shall discuss in details the modalities for seeing this transaction
through. Your quick response will be highly appreciated. Thank you in
anticipation of your cooperation.
Yours faithfully,
Dr. Williams Ajebor.
